Doors that aren't closing

Sagging doors are a typical problem for homeowners. They scrape the door jamb and can cause damage to the frame and paint. This issue can also affect the efficiency of your home, which can result in higher utility bills. But there are some simple actions you can take to resolve this problem.

Then then, tighten the hinges that are loose. This is an easy repair and will usually suffice to fix the sagging door. Use a screwdriver to tighten the screws on each of the hinges. Be careful not to tighten the screws too tightly as this can cause the hinge to go out of alignment.

If you notice that your hinges aren't working it could be an indication that they're past the point of their lifespan and will need to be replaced. Make sure you use the same kind of hinges as those you have, as different types of hinges can differ and not work properly with your door.

Doors that don't close properly

Doors that do not close properly are among the most common issues that can be found in any kind of door. The reason for this can be in a variety of ways, including weather or age, as well as usage. This is a common issue that can be easily fixed.

The most frequent cause of this issue is that the latch isn't centered on the strike plate. This will cause the door to clatter and may not fully close. Make sure the latch is in contact with the strike plate above or beneath the hole, and then move the latch in accordance with this.

Another reason that could be behind this problem is that the hinges are loose or too tight. The hinges that are loose could pose a serious danger to safety and must be tightened, or replaced. A professional installer can accomplish this.

It's also worth checking if the track or rails are rusted or damaged. In some cases the rails or tracks may need to be replaced completely.

Doors that are stuck

Doors are an essential component of every home. They can be used to separate the inside from the outside, shut the closet, or conceal storage, doors are necessary. They're often taken for granted when they work well, but they can be a big nuisance when they do not. Luckily, the majority of doors remain stuck for only a few seconds at a time, and are easily fixed with a bit of patience.

There are many possible causes of a door that is stuck. One of the possible causes could be a loose hinge or strike plate. It's also possible that the screws are stripped. If this is the case tightening the screws can resolve the issue. If the problem is caused by humidity, try using a dehumidifier to reduce the amount of moisture in the area.

A latch or knob that isn't completely locked is a common cause of a stuck door. The strike plate may be pushed backwards. Make sure that the latch is secured correctly by tightening the strike plate screws. It's also an excellent idea to clean the latch and look for any obstructions that may hinder its use.

Doors that are damaged

Doors are subjected to a lot wear and tear, whether it's due to physical impacts or the weather. This can lead to a variety of problems, including water exposure and cracks. Luckily, repairing interior doors is a simple job that anyone can accomplish with the right tools and materials.

The most common problem that bifold doors face is when they start to sag or scrape against the floor. This is usually caused by misalignment or broken parts. In most cases it's a simple solution, but it takes patience and basic knowledge. First, you will need to remove the hardware from the door, including handles and hinges. This will allow you to gain access to the damaged area. Utilize a screwdriver for the removal and remove the parts from the door frame. Then you can sand the rough areas using coarse and fine grit paper. Be sure to sand the grain of the wood to avoid damaging it further.

Once the surface of your door is smooth, you can apply the paint. If the damage to the door's surface is not too significant the application of a coat of paint is enough to hide any imperfections. However, if the damage is more extensive, you may need to paint the entire area of the door.
